
City of Marshall
The City of Marshall was incorporated in 1872 and its charter was adopted on August 22, 1969. Marshall's government structure is Home Rule Charter, operated by a Mayor/City Council with an appointed city administrator. Six council members and a voting mayor oversee the city, with the assistance of fifteen active citizen boards and commissions. The City employs 94 people, and also oversees the Marshall Municipal Utilities, Avera Marshall Regional Medical Center, the Marshall/Lyon County Library and the Marshall Public Housing Commission.
With a total city budget of $24,331,381 for the year 2006, the City operates sixteen departments. Marshall's City Hall is located in the downtown business district at 344 West Main. It is open from 8 AM until 5 PM. You may reach the city via the city administrators office at 537-6760.
Lyon County
Marshall is the county seat of Lyon County, located in Southwest Minnesota.
